Clay will eventually be built into the Pebble SDK. However, while it is still in beta you will need to follow the steps shown below:
|
||||
|
||||
1. Download the Clay distribution file from: [dist/clay.js](dist/clay.js).
|
||||
1. Download the **clay.js** distribution file from the [latest release](releases/latest).
|
||||
2. Drop `clay.js` in your project's `src/js` directory.
|
||||
3. Create a JSON file called `config.json` and place it in your `src/js` directory.
|
||||
4. In order for JSON files to work you may need to change a line in your `wscript` from `ctx.pbl_bundle(binaries=binaries, js=ctx.path.ant_glob('src/js/**/*.js'))` to `ctx.pbl_bundle(binaries=binaries, js=ctx.path.ant_glob(['src/js/**/*.js', 'src/js/**/*.json']))`.
